Netflix Likely Tests Long-Term Subscription Plans With Up To 50% Discount In India
Netflix, one of the popular video streaming service is used by millions of people across the world. In India, it is among the most expensive services. While the high subscription cost remains to be a challenge in increasing the number of users, the company seems to have come up with new long-term plans.
Netflix Tests Long-Term Plans
As per a report by Gadgets 360, Netflix is testing long-term subscription plans in India. What's interesting is that India is said to be the first market for the service to test the same. As of now, it is being tested on three months, six months, and an annual basis along with attractive discounts of up to 50% as compared to the existing monthly plans.
The report notes that subscribers who opt for the long-term subscription plans on Netflix will get discounts on Mobile, Basic, Standard, and Premium plans. Currently, it is limited only to select users and is meant for both mobile and web users. How Will It Be Beneficial
Talking about discounts, the regular Netflix Premium subscription for three months is priced at Rs. 2,397 but the long-term plan (for 3 months) is available at a 20% discount at Rs. 1,919. Likewise, the service will be priced at Rs. 4,794 for six months but with the long-term subscription plan offering a 30% discount, it will cost Rs. 3,359.
Furthermore, the annual plan will be available for Rs. 4,799, which is after getting a 50% discount on the regular Premium subscription for 12 months priced at Rs. 9,588 (Rs. 799 per month).
What We Think
The report mentions that long-term Netflix plans are under pilot testing. So, it will not be available for all users. And, there is no confirmation if the same will be rolled out to all Netflix subscribers. With the new long-term plans and attractive discounts, the video streaming service can retain subscribers for a longer time. And, it will be on par with rivals such as Amazon Prime Video, Hotstar, etc. offering annual subscription plans.
